Rolled Aluminium: Properties and Applications

Milled aluminium is a flexible product prized for its unique combination of characteristics . Its minimal density , excellent corrosion immunity , and high tenacity make it ideal for a broad range of functions. Typical uses include wrapping for provisions, beverage vessels, vehicle components , building sheets , and energy wires . The possibility to easily shape it into intricate designs further enhances its appeal across various fields.
